## Article Body

Iranian President Masoud Pezeshkian has declared U.S. demands for unconditional surrender as “impossible and unattainable.” This development comes amid a fragile ceasefire in the ongoing U.S.-Iran conflict, which followed military escalations earlier in 2026. The U.S. has maintained a naval blockade on Iranian ports, severely impacting Iran’s economy with daily losses estimated at $500 million. Despite a round of face-to-face talks and ongoing diplomacy led by Pakistan, Pezeshkian’s statement underscores continued resistance to U.S. pressure. The situation remains tense with limited military exchanges ongoing in the Strait of Hormuz, reflecting the complexity and volatility of the geopolitical landscape.
